Luis Aburto

CEO at Scio

Luis Aburto began their work experience in 1993 as a Project Manager at SHIASA. Luis then worked as a Consultant and Project Engineer at Malcolm Pirnie, Inc. from 1999 to 2001. Following that, they held a position as a Senior Consultant at both First American Corporation and InVictus Technologies from 2001 to 2003. In 2003, they became the CEO of Scio Consulting, where they provided software engineering teams for tech companies. In 2012, they founded Cloudancy and also became the President of Venture Traction, a division of Scio that focused on helping entrepreneurs and organizations with Lean Startup principles. In 2017, they became the CTO of Trio Rewards, Inc., a mobile app platform. Additionally, they worked as a Professor at ITESM from 2003 to 2004.

Luis Aburto has a diverse education history that spans over several decades. In 1985, they enrolled at the Instituto Tecnologico de Morelia, where they pursued a Bachelor's degree in Engineering. Luis completed their undergraduate studies in 1990. Following this, in 1992, Luis attended the University of Strathclyde, where they pursued a Master's degree in Computer Aided Engineering Design. Luis completed their studies in 1993. In 1997, Luis embarked on another educational journey at The University of Texas at Austin. Here, they pursued a Master of Science degree in Engineering, which they completed in 1999. Most recently, in 2015, Luis attended the Harvard Business School Executive Education program, where they further honed their skills in business management and leadership with a focus on Leading Professional Service Firms.
